Table II.

Top 10 dermatologic medications in the United States Food and Drug Administration Adverse Event Reporting Database (FAERS) associated with taste disturbances, with the corresponding clinical trial data and the number of cases reports or case series in PubMed

Medication Cases in FAERS (% of all ageusia/dysgeusia/taste disturbance cases Rank of all medications associated with ageusia/dysgeusia/taste disturbance Clinical trial data Case reports/cases series in PubMed, No.
Vismodegib (oral) 1054 (1.69) 11 of 2591 67% 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ase III clinical trials, ageusia/dysgeusia were reported in phase IV trials 2
Etanercept (injection) 937 (1.50) 14 of 2591 No 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ase III clinical trials, no 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ase IV trials 1
Terbinafine hydrochloride (oral) 920 (1.47) 15 of 2591 2.8% 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ase III clinical trials, ageusia/dysgeusia were reported in phase IV trials 9
Apremilast (oral) 223 (0.36) 71 of 2591 No 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ase III clinical trials, no 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ase IV trials 1
Methotrexate (oral) 176 (0.28) 105 of 2591 No 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ase III clinical trials, no 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ase IV trials 1
Secukinumab (injection) 151 (0.24) 296 of 2591 No 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ase III clinical trials, no 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ase IV trials 0
Spironolactone (oral) 68 (0.11) 376 of 2591 No 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ase III clinical trials, no 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ase IV trials 0
Isotretinoin (oral) 57 (0.09) 430 of 2591 No 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ase III clinical trials, no 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ase IV trials 2
Tacrolimus (23 topical, 20 oral) 43 (0.07) 689 of 2591 No 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ase III clinical trials, no 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ase IV trials 0
Mycophenolate sodium (oral) 42 (0.07) 691 of 2591 No 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ase III clinical trials, no ageusia/dysgeusia reported in phase IV trials 0

There were 62,524 cases of taste disturbances reported to FAERS from January 1, 1969, to December 31, 2019, using the key words ageusia, dysgeusia, and taste disturbance.
